Magic Of Japanese Cherry Trees In Spring

One of the best things in spring is blooming cherry trees. There is a special magic that wears these pink flowers that make us love flew few  degree more.

Cherry trees are scattered across the world, and all recognize their beauty that lasts briefly. Japanese in their honor have Sakura Matsuri or Festival of flowering cherry trees and this beautiful This year’s photographs of blossoming Japanese cherry trees. Enjoy.

Beautiful Cherry Blossoms swirl around the stunning shape of Osaka Castle in Japan.



Leave a Reply

Your email address will not be published. Required fields are marked *